If you were sent home with one, how long did you keep it on for? I haven't taken mine off yet and it's day 4. I'm getting real itchy under there, too. I also have been avoiding the shower, which I plan on taking today. How did you shower? Normal, just ignore the incisions?

I didn't have a waist binder with my WLS (I did have an abdominal binder with my plastic surgery, though). I just showered as normal. The surgical glue (on my incisions) after both surgeries eventually came off (without my help!) after about four weeks.

I wore mine for 3 days once I was discharged. That was when I took my first shower and after removing it and realizing there was no additional pain from not having it on, I figured I was in good enough shape to go without it. Trying removing it for that shower and see how things feel. You can always put it back on if you feel better with it on.

I had my surgery July 14th and my doctor told me that other than showering I was to wear it for two weeks straight 24/7. It is itchy, especially in this very hot weather we are having. But I do feel protected when it's on.
